Bob's Burgers Movie Pitch
• A chance meeting between Bob's rich friend Warren Fitzgerald and famous chef Skip Marooch leads to an opportunity to open the restaurant of his dreams
• Linda encourages Bob to go after his dream, and insists he consult his father whose health has recently been on the decline
• Mr Frond announces to the school that a talent scout for a music and arts school is coming to recruit new students, and that a talent show will be held for students.
• Gene decides he's going to enter the talent show with an original musical number. The rest of the film is depicted as a musical as Gene tries to determine what he wants to sing for the show.
• Tina is preparing to graduate from middle school to high school, but she's thrown for a loop when Jimmy Jr asks her to be his girlfriend once summer starts. She's conflicted as to whether she wants to be single going in to high school or finally be with the boy she's been pining after.
• Louise, realizing she may lose both of her siblings if Gene gets into the art school, hatches a plot to ruin the talent show with the help of Rudy, Darryl, Andy, Ollie, and Milly.
• Bob and Linda get their new restaurant, Bob's Burger Bistro, on the pier. Things begin running smoothly at first, but the large staff and work load weighs on Bob.
• Gene has problems writing his musical number for the talent show and tries talking to Bob about it, but is turned away.
• Bob and Linda get into an argument about his overworking and becoming distant with the kids as they aren't working in the restaurant as much.
• Tina continues hanging out with Jimmy Jr while debating being his girlfriend. She's further conflicted when she discovers Zeke has feelings for her.
• Louise works on her plan to sabotage the talent show, but Rudy confronts her motives and points out that she can't let things go, much like how she's never been able to take off her hat.
• Bob's father has a heart attack and is taken to the hospital, but Bob stays for the dinner rush while Linda goes to the hospital.
• Bob finishes the shift and closes the restaurant when Linda shows back up and informs him that his father didn't survive. Bob breaks down outside the store while Gene watches on.
• The day of the talent show arrives a week later  and Gene and Louise are getting ready for the big night. Linda asks Bob to go support Gene, and he relents.
• The night of the talent show starts, and Louise and co. start to enact their plan to ruin it.
• Tina goes to the show with Jimmy Junior, but a fight erupts between him and Zeke in the hallway before the show. Zeke reveals that Jimmy Junior only asked Tina out because he was afraid of getting bullied as a freshman and having a girlfriend would protect him.
• Gene starts his musical number right as Louise is going to finalize her sabotage on a rafter above the stage. Gene enacts a scene about Bob when he found about his father dying, and he sings about wanting to make him proud and wishing they had more time together.
• Bob is moved to tears by Gene's performance and realizes he was happier running a small restaurant with his family.
• Louise is also moved, realizing how much Gene loves to perform and how great he is at it. She feels selfish for trying to stifle his dreams and tells her crew that the plan is off.
• Louise starts walking down off the rafters, but slips and catches her hat in a rafter. Bob and Linda run to the stage to save her, and Bob shouts that the only way is for Louise to take off her hat. She relents, but finally let's go and falls into Bob's arms.
• Cut to a few months later. The bistro is closed, but the Belcher family is gathering around the old restaurant for the Grand Re-re-re-re-opening.
•  Zeke is there too, having been hired on as a trainee grill cook. Tina hints that she may have a crush on him now, too.
• Louise talkes to Gene starting at the art school soon, and he says he's nervous but excited. Gene asks if she's gonna be okay without him, but she reassures him that she'll be fine just as her crew shows up.
• Linda asks Bob if he's happy giving up his dream to cook all day with her, and he tells her that is his dream and they kiss.
• The fucking END.
